Chapter 8: Problem 22
If Mozart composed his first music at the age of 4 and continued composing and performing until he died at the age of \(35,\) what percent of his life was spent composing music?

Step by step solution
01
Calculate the years Mozart composed music
Subtract the age when Mozart started composing music (4 years) from his total age when he died (35 years) to find the total number of years he was composing music:
\(35 - 4 = 31\) years
Mozart spent 31 years of his life composing music.
02
Calculate the percentage of his life spent composing music
Now, we need to calculate the percentage of Mozart's life spent composing music. We do this by dividing the number of years he composed music (31 years) by his total age at the time of his death (35 years), then multiply the result by 100:
\(\frac{31}{35} \times 100\%\)
03
Simplify the fraction and calculate the percentage
Now, we'll simplify the fraction \(\frac{31}{35}\) and calculate the percentage:
\(\frac{31}{35} \approx 0.8857\)
Then multiply by 100 to get the percentage:
\(0.8857 \times 100\% \approx 88.57\%\)
So, Mozart spent approximately \(88.57\%\) of his life composing music.
